    Quick Info – MG Majestor Highlights

    CategoryDetails
    Model NameMG Majestor 2025
    Engine Type2.0L Turbo Petrol or Diesel (expected)
    Transmission6 Speed Manual or Automatic
    Power OutputApprox 190 bhp
    Seating Capacity7 Seater
    Launch DateMid 2025 (expected)
    Expected Price₹25 to ₹35 Lakh (ex showroom)
    Key RivalsToyota Fortuner, Mahindra XUV700, Tata Safari

    Safety and Technology

    Safety has always been MG’s strong area, and the MG Majestor follows the same path. Multiple airbags, ABS, EBD, traction control – all expected. MG might also add ADAS features like adaptive cruise control, lane assist, and emergency braking. These systems will make long drives a lot safer and easier. The SUV also supports voice control through MG’s i-SMART system, letting you operate features with simple commands. There’s a strong build quality that you can feel just by closing the door.     Price and Launch Date in India

    The MG Majestor is expected to reach Indian showrooms around mid 2025. Prices could start near ₹25 lakh and go up to ₹35 lakh for higher variants. MG plans to position it slightly above the Gloster, targeting people who want something more refined and futuristic. Bookings might begin a few months before launch. The company knows this is an important car for its image in India. Once launched, it’s expected to attract customers who want a premium SUV without spending luxury brand money.
